I am satisfied with our progress – China coach Jiande Xu

 

Ankara, Turkey, August 17, 2015 – Titleholder China outclassed Cuba 3-0 (25-6, 25-8, 25-8) at 2015 FIVB Volleyball Women’s U23 World Championship in Ankara, Turkey on Monday evening. Read what coaches and captains said after the match. 

China coach Jiande Xu: Expect for today’s match, we always needed some time to get into the matches. However, I am satisfied with our progress. 

China captain Xintong Chen: The key match was against Dominican Republic. They are very tall and played with a strong offense. We couldn’t stop them. That’s why we eventually finished third in our group and missed the semifinals. 

Cuba coach Wilfredo Robinson:  We were demoralised at the beginning of the match and lacked in defence. The players were mentally tired and couldn’t concentrate on the match. I think Turkey have a great chance of winning the tournament, I wish them good luck.
 
Cuba player Claudia Hernandez: We made a lot of mistakes during the games and lacked in experience as we weren’t prepared to play as a complete team, though the overall experience has been positive.
